St John’s-on-the-Lake

 

St. John's-on-the-Lake is a church located on Bear Island and was founded in 1927 as a summer chapel.  Under the management of the St. John's-on-the-Lake Association, summer worship services are organized to meet the needs of Winnipesaukee island residents.

​

Regardless of your religious affiliation at home, St. John's-on-the-Lake welcomes those of all faiths.  It is also available by reservation for private services and has been the site for numerous island baptisms, weddings and memorial services. 


The chapel is located at the largest elevation of Lake Winnipesaukee's Bear Island.  It can be reached by a marked trail (approximately 1000 feet) that leads from the church docks in Deep Cove on Bear Island's west side. Services are held at 10:00 am Sunday mornings during the summer season.

 

Sunday dress is casual and sneakers or sturdy shoes are highly suggested due to the moderately elevated trail walk to the chapel.

 

A unique feature of Sunday services at St. John's is that well behaved dogs are always welcome.
